Utilizing ERP to Automate Customer Service Tasks

Customer service is a critical component of any successful business. It is essential to ensure that customers are satisfied with their experience and that their needs are met in a timely and efficient manner. To ensure that customer service is handled effectively, many businesses are turning to enterprise resource planning (ERP) systems to automate customer service tasks.

ERP systems are designed to streamline and automate business processes, including customer service. By integrating customer service tasks into the ERP system, businesses can reduce manual labor and improve customer service efficiency. ERP systems can be used to automate customer service tasks such as order processing, customer inquiries, and customer feedback.

Order processing is one of the most common customer service tasks that can be automated with an ERP system. ERP systems can be used to track orders, process payments, and generate invoices. This eliminates the need for manual data entry and reduces the time it takes to process orders.

Customer inquiries can also be automated with an ERP system. ERP systems can be used to store customer information, such as contact details and order history. This information can be used to quickly respond to customer inquiries and provide personalized customer service.

Customer feedback is another important customer service task that can be automated with an ERP system. ERP systems can be used to collect customer feedback and analyze it to identify areas of improvement. This helps businesses to better understand their customers and improve their customer service.

By automating customer service tasks with an ERP system, businesses can reduce manual labor and improve customer service efficiency. This can help businesses to provide better customer service and increase customer satisfaction.

Q&A

Q1: What is ERP?
A1: ERP stands for Enterprise Resource Planning, and it is a type of software that helps businesses manage their operations, including customer service. It is designed to integrate all aspects of a business, from finance and accounting to inventory and customer service.

Q2: How can ERP help with customer service management?
A2: ERP can help with customer service management by providing a centralized platform for tracking customer interactions, managing customer data, and automating customer service processes. It can also help businesses identify areas of improvement and provide insights into customer behavior.

Q3: What are the benefits of leveraging ERP for customer service management?
A3: Leveraging ERP for customer service management can help businesses improve customer satisfaction, reduce costs, and increase efficiency. It can also help businesses gain insights into customer behavior and preferences, allowing them to better tailor their services to meet customer needs.

Q4: What are some of the challenges associated with leveraging ERP for customer service management?
A4: Some of the challenges associated with leveraging ERP for customer service management include the cost of implementation, the complexity of the system, and the need for ongoing maintenance and support. Additionally, it can be difficult to integrate ERP with existing systems and processes.

Q5: What are some best practices for leveraging ERP for customer service management?
A5: Some best practices for leveraging ERP for customer service management include ensuring that the system is properly configured and integrated with existing systems, training staff on how to use the system, and regularly monitoring and evaluating the system to ensure it is meeting customer service needs. Additionally, it is important to ensure that customer data is secure and that customer privacy is respected.
